电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机涉及哪些内容

2023-10-19 02:54分类:电工基础知识 阅读:

 

单片机是一种集成电路,内部集成了处理器、存储器和各种外设接口等功能模块。它广泛应用于各个领域,如家电、通信、汽车等。单片机涉及的内容非常丰富,包括硬件设计、软件开发、通信接口等多个方面。

硬件设计是单片机应用中的重要环节之一。在硬件设计中,需要考虑电路的稳定性、可靠性和功能性。需要根据具体应用需求选择合适的单片机型号,并设计电路板。电路板中包含了单片机、外围器件和电源等部分。还需要进行电路布线和焊接等工作,确保电路板的正常工作。硬件设计还包括外设接口的设计,如LCD显示屏、按键、传感器等的连接和控制。

软件开发是单片机应用中不可或缺的一部分。软件开发主要涉及编程语言和开发工具的选择,以及程序设计和调试。单片机常用的编程语言有汇编语言和C语言。汇编语言直接操作单片机的寄存器和指令,能够充分发挥单片机的性能。而C语言更易于编写和调试,适合开发复杂的应用程序。开发工具包括编译器、调试器和仿真器等,用于编译、调试和测试程序。程序设计需要根据具体应用需求,编写相应的算法和逻辑。调试是软件开发过程中的重要环节,通过调试可以发现和解决程序中的错误。

通信接口是单片机应用中常用的一种功能。单片机通过通信接口与外部设备进行数据交换和通信。常用的通信接口有串口、并口、SPI、I2C等。串口是一种常见的通信接口,可以实现单片机与计算机、传感器、显示屏等设备之间的数据传输。并口是一种并行通信接口,适用于高速数据传输。SPI和I2C是一种串行通信接口,适用于多个设备之间的通信。

除了硬件设计、软件开发和通信接口,单片机还涉及其他一些内容。例如,单片机应用中常用的外设有LCD显示屏、按键、蜂鸣器、电机驱动器等。这些外设可以实现与用户的交互和控制。单片机还可以实现定时器、中断、PWM等功能,用于实现定时、计数、脉宽调制等应用。

单片机涉及的内容非常丰富,包括硬件设计、软件开发、通信接口等多个方面。在单片机应用中,需要进行合理的硬件设计,选择合适的编程语言和开发工具进行软件开发,以及使用适当的通信接口与外部设备进行数据交换。还需要熟悉常用的外设和功能模块,以实现各种应用需求。

上一篇:单片机流水灯设计

下一篇:单片机温室大棚

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部